A young Martin Cullen from his first General Election in 1987. Martin Cullen had been an Independent councillor(as his father had been too) before joining the PDs.
Here in 1987 he was ‘A fighter for Waterford’ …….
Martin was, amongst other things, looking for ‘……a more Professional Dail with fewer TDs….’
He switched to Fianna Fail after the 1992 General Election.

Chris Andrews -Fianna Fail -1999 Local Elections Pembroke March 4, 2010
From the 1999 local elections, Fianna Fail candidate Chris Andrews running in the Pembroke Ward. Chris Andrews was elected, his running mate Liz Donnelly lost out.
He lost his seat in 2004, before being co-opted in 2006 and then winning a Dail seat in Dublin South East in 2007.
Chris Andrews is son of Niall Andrews, grandson of Todd Andrews, nephew of David Andrews and of course a cousin of amongst others Dun Laoghaire TD Barry Andrews and RTEs Ryan Tubridy.
Again for a Dublin South East based candidate the background for the photo is the Pidgeon house. Amongst the issues covered here are the needs for Taxi deregulation and more recycling and better waste management.

Denis O’Donovan -Fianna Fail- Cork South West 2007
From the 2007 General Election. Fianna Fail candidate in Cork South West, the now Senator Denis O’Donovan.
Denis O’Donovan lost his seat despite party colleague Joe Walsh retiring. Instead Independent Christy O’Sullivan was recruited and stood on the Fianna Fail ticket with O’Donovan and it was O’Sullivan who won the Fianna Fail seat.

Anne Brady, Michael Cotter, Paddy Madigan -Fianna Fail -Blackrock 1985 LE March 3, 2010
From the 1985 Local Elections, The Fianna Fail candidates for Blackrock Anne Brady, Michael Cotter and Paddy Madigan. As far as I’m aware Anne Brady and Paddy Madigan were elected. Paddy Madigan was elected again in 1991. He then fell out with Fianna Fail (or they fell out with him) somewhere along the way and ran as an Independent in the 1994 European Elections and the 1997 General Election.
Michael Cotter ran again in 1991 and failed to win a seat. He is a Lecturer/ Academic in DCU.
Anne Brady a councillor since 1979 lost her seat in the 1991 Elections.

Maria Corrigan – Fianna Fail -2007 Dublin South February 23, 2010
From the 2007 General Election, a flyer from Fianna Fail Candidate Maria Corrigan. Maria Corrigan was originally elected to the council for Glencullen in 1999. She failed to win a seat in both the 2002 and 2007 General Elections. However she was appointed to the Seanad by then Taoiseach Bertie Ahern in 2007.
WIth the passing of Seamus Brennan and Tom Kitts impending retirement she is thought to have a good chance of winning a Fianna Fail nomination for the next election.
